Mojec International Holdings – one of Africa’s leading conglomerates with business interest in Power, Technology, Real Estate and Agriculture has been listed as one of the ‘Companies to Inspire Africa’ in 2019 by the London Stock Exchange Group (LSEG), an international market infrastructural business which focuses on capital formation, intellectual property and risk and balance sheet management.

The ‘Companies To Inspire Africa’, CTIA, is prestigious annual report compiled by the London Stock Exchange Group to identify most inspirational, dynamic, privately owned high-growth companies investing in the real sector of the economy and African continent that are making significant socio-economic impact by creating substantial numbers of jobs and have the potential to be publicly listed within the next few years. The growth rates and sector diversity of these firms featured in the report highlights their potential to transform the African and wider economy.

Over 5000 companies were recommended and shortlisted across the continent, only 5% of these companies from 32 different countries made the list. The companies that made the list boast of an average compound annual growth rate of 46%, up from 16% last year. On average, each firm employs over 350 people, with an average compound annual employee growth rate of 25%.

About Mojec International

Established in 1985, MOJEC International Holdings headquartered in Lagos with operations in Power, Technology, Real Estate as well as Agriculture.

Its subsidiary, Mojec Meter Asset Management Company is the largest meter manufacturer in West and East Africa. As a leading indigenous manufacturer and contractor to power utilities in Nigeria and across the western hemisphere. Mojec has an installed production capacity of up to 1 million meters annually.

Mojec is primarily known on the continent as a market leader and innovator in metering. Today, Mojec remains at the forefront of Metering Technology and boasts over 80% market penetration rate in the Nigerian Electricity market with over 8 out of 11 of the utilities as clients.
